How material science breakthroughs, evolving reimbursement dynamics, and digital integration are jointly accelerating the maturation of bioactive wound care products

The bioactive wound care landscape is in the midst of transformative shifts driven by material science breakthroughs, regulatory clarity, and changing care delivery models. Innovations in polymers, hydrogels, and biologically derived matrices are enabling dressings and substitutes to provide targeted growth factors, sustained release of antimicrobials, and cellular support that mimic physiological healing environments. Concurrently, manufacturers are adopting advanced manufacturing techniques, including precision casting and aseptic processing, to improve consistency and scalability, while suppliers negotiate tighter quality controls and traceability to meet evolving regulatory expectations.

Health systems are recalibrating procurement and clinical pathways to emphasize products that demonstrate meaningful clinical endpoints, such as reduced time to wound closure and fewer complications. Reimbursement frameworks are shifting toward outcome-based contracting in some markets, prompting companies to invest in robust post-market evidence generation and real-world data collection. Digital health integration, including remote monitoring platforms and wound imaging, is enhancing clinician oversight and enabling longitudinal outcomes tracking, which in turn supports value propositions to payers and providers. Together, these shifts are accelerating the maturation of the category from a mix of niche innovations to a more coordinated ecosystem where clinical utility, supply chain integrity, and evidence generation determine winners.

Assessing how tariff adjustments in 2025 reshaped sourcing strategies, procurement scrutiny, and supply chain resilience across the wound care ecosystem

Tariff policies enacted in 2025 introduced new variables into the cost and supply dynamics for wound care manufacturers, distributors, and providers. Adjustments to import duties on raw materials and finished medical devices have amplified the emphasis on supply chain transparency and sourcing strategies. In response, many stakeholders reassessed supplier portfolios, explored nearshoring opportunities to reduce exposure to cross-border tariff volatility, and renegotiated contracts to include clauses that mitigate risk related to sudden policy shifts. These measures were accompanied by a renewed focus on inventory management and production flexibility to preserve continuity of care for patients dependent on advanced wound therapies.

The tariff environment also influenced procurement behaviors among large health systems and group purchasing organizations, which became more exacting in their evaluation of total cost of ownership. Payers and institutional buyers scrutinized comparative product economics, favoring suppliers who could demonstrate consistent supply, local manufacturing capability, or clear cost-containment strategies. At the same time, manufacturers accelerated efforts to optimize product formulations and packaging to reduce weight and import complexity, thereby attenuating tariff exposure. While tariffs introduced short- to medium-term headwinds for imported finished goods and specialty components, they also catalyzed strategic shifts toward diversified sourcing, greater vertical integration, and more sophisticated commercial dialogues centered on resilience and predictability.

Deep segmentation insights revealing how product subtypes, wound indications, care settings, and distribution channels define differentiated strategies for adoption and commercialization

Segment-level dynamics reveal nuanced opportunities and challenges across product types, wound indications, care settings, and distribution pathways. Within product categories, dressings that combine structural support with biologically active components are gaining traction; alginate dressings, differentiated by calcium and sodium formulations, continue to serve as absorptive interfaces for exudative wounds, while collagen dressings that draw on avian, bovine, human, and porcine sources are being evaluated for their capacity to support cellular integration and matrix remodeling. Thin, conformable film dressings-typically polyurethane-remain important for superficial wounds and as secondary interfaces, whereas foam dressings in polyurethane and silicone variants provide cushioning and high absorbency in pressure and traumatic wound care. Hydrogel dressings, available in amorphous, impregnated, and sheet formats, maintain relevance where moisture balance and autolytic debridement are priorities. Skin substitutes, encompassing allograft, biosynthetic, synthetic, and xenograft options, represent a strategic frontier for restoring tissue continuity in complex ulcers and burns and require rigorous manufacturing and regulatory controls.

When viewed through the lens of wound type, treatments for burns, diabetic foot ulcers, pressure ulcers, traumatic wounds, and venous leg ulcers demand differentiated product attributes and clinical pathways. Acute wounds and surgical wounds call for solutions that reduce infection risk and support rapid closure, while chronic wounds and diabetic foot ulcers necessitate long-term management strategies that address biofilm, perfusion deficits, and comorbidity management. End-user preferences vary across ambulatory surgical centers, home healthcare programs, hospitals, and specialty clinics, with each setting prioritizing distinct operational and clinical criteria such as ease of application, dressing change frequency, and compatibility with telehealth monitoring. Distribution channels bifurcate into offline and online pathways, each influencing procurement cycles, clinical training opportunities, and patient access models. Taken together, these segmentation dimensions underscore the importance of aligning product design, clinical evidence, and commercial models to the specific needs of each use case and care delivery environment.

Regional dynamics and strategic levers that determine adoption pathways for bioactive wound care across the Americas, Europe Middle East & Africa, and Asia-Pacific

Regional dynamics influence technology adoption, procurement behavior, and clinical practice patterns across the Americas, Europe, Middle East & Africa, and Asia-Pacific. In the Americas, integrated delivery networks and a mix of private and public payers drive demand for products that can demonstrate clinical and economic value across inpatient and outpatient pathways. Regulatory frameworks and reimbursement processes in Europe, Middle East & Africa create a mosaic of adoption timelines, with centralized clinical guidelines in some countries juxtaposed against fragmented payer environments elsewhere, encouraging targeted market entry strategies and localized evidence generation. The Asia-Pacific region shows rapid uptake of innovative therapies in urban centers, accompanied by growing domestic manufacturing capability and increasing investments in clinician training and infrastructure that support advanced wound care deployment.

Each region presents distinct operational considerations: procurement cycles and contracting practices differ, clinician workflows and caregiver roles vary, and the maturity of home healthcare and outpatient services shapes product design priorities such as ease of use and extended wear. Cross-border partnerships, technology transfer agreements, and local regulatory navigation are common strategic levers employed by organizations seeking to scale across multiple regions. As such, companies must calibrate their market access plans to regional reimbursement architectures, supply chain realities, and clinical education needs to optimize uptake and ensure equitable patient access to bioactive wound care innovations.
